Position Overview:


To provide efficient and effective technical maintenance support to the school by ensuring that school facilities are taken care of by fixing, renewing, and rebuilding as per the maintenance tickets.

Provide ongoing and generic maintenance duties throughout the school.


Qualifications:


  • Grade 12 or N4 Technical qualification
  • Relevant Certificate in (basic plumbing, carpentry, and building repairs)
  • Basic computer certificate will be an added advantage
  • Driver's licence will be an added advantage

Attributes:


  • Ability to communicate in English (speak, read, and write)
  • Multilingual will be an added advantage
  • Honesty and integrity
  • Health and Safety sensitive
  • Able to follow verbal directions
  • Ability to pay attention to details
  • Good interpersonal skills
  • Sound technical knowledge

Preferred skills and experience:


  • 2 years' previous experience as a maintenance, grounds, and plumbing
  • Building, construction, and facilities experience obtained from a schooling environment will be an added advantage.
  • Extreme safe sensitivity and constant alertness.
  • Physical fitness to lift items and work on heights.
  • General understanding of various maintenance tools.
  • Ability to fix bathrooms, change and clean floor and wall tiles.
  • Basic painting, roofing, electrical, building, and construction skills.
  • Basic landscaping skills will be an added advantage.
  • Have good handeye coordination.
  • Physically able to reach, stretch, bend, and walk during the daily routine, with the ability to stand for long lengths of time.
  • Basic understanding of the Health & Safety Act and its requirements.

Duties and Responsibilities:


  • Perform basic technical or handyman work such as basic plumbing, basic electrical assistance, and basic building, and equipment repairs.
  • Fix all facility technical deficiencies reported through the maintenance tickets.
  • Daily maintenance of bathrooms/classrooms/corridors and grounds.
  • Notify management of occurring deficiencies or needs for repairs.
  • Maintaining and upkeep of all cleaning equipment, supplies, and products.
  • Disposal of trash from bins transporting waste material to designated collection points.
  • Assist with any other duties as prescribed by the Supervisor / Manager.
  • Follow all rules relating to the Facilities Management system.
  • Attend ongoing maintenance of buildings and grounds as logged through the ticket.

School Hours:

This is a 45-hour per-week position and may be required to work longer hours from time to time.
